Job description

Description

This is a full-time NOCC Engineer role. The NOCC Engineer will be responsible for monitoring and maintaining network systems, identifying and troubleshooting issues. You would be working closely with the Incident Management, IT teams and 3rd party service providers to ensure the availability of all systems & applications to our internal users & external members.

Roles And Responsibilities
  • Actively monitoring and troubleshooting incidents related to Global Network infrastructure & services ensuring optimal performance
  • Act as first responders helping to organize and control incident response & troubleshoot issues
  • Monitor all the Consoles and Immediate response to alerts generated from the monitoring tools, indulge in investigation
  • Timely update, escalation and resolution of network tickets
  • Perform daily Health Check for Network, ensuring Network Uptime and service availability as per SLA
  • Liaison with different Internal and External stakeholder including customers, vendor, carrier/circuit providers etc.
  • Implementation of standard network changes
  • Collaborate with Lead and Specialists for implementation of Migration/Upgrade Activities.
  • Engage in Commission and Decommission Network equipment, services and circuits
  • Document the SOPs, KBAs, RCAs, network diagrams.
  • CCNA / Equivalent certification is mandatory (within 6 months of Joining, if not certified already)
Desired Skills
  • Routing & Switching (TCP/IP, Routing protocols like OSPF & BGP, IP addressing, DDI protocols)
  • Good Understanding on Cisco & Arista Routers and Switches, for gather diagnostics and do initial troubleshooting
  • Understanding on Wireless Standards & Security features, for gather diagnostics and do initial troubleshooting
  • Ability to do advanced routing/switching, FW troubleshooting
  • Understanding of Palo Alto and/or Fortinet Operations, ability to check routing and firewall rules, ability to analyze traffic logs
  • Understanding of Monitoring Tools like SolarWinds/Splunk etc.
  • Basic Understanding on GCP Cloud.
  • Basic Understanding of polling methods like SNMP/ICMP/WMI/Agents etc.
  • Understanding of IT Infrastructure to be able to effectively escal
  • Ability to aid IT Teams as or when needed and work closely with the vendors.
  • Comfortable in working on weekend shifts.
  • Ability to multitask and handle multiple alerts
  • Excellent verbal and written skills
  • Ability to Collaborate across departments and work as part of a team.
Good To Have
  • Understanding of GlobalProtect Operations, ability to gather and analyze user logs and troubleshooting
  • Knowledge on Configuring, Monitoring and tracking Alerts generated by different Monitoring Systems (Solarwinds, Splunk etc).
  • Understanding of Jira Software for project and issue tracking, and managing agile workflows, and Confluence for knowledge base and articles.
  • Understanding of Multicast concepts like PIM-SM, MSDP, AnyCastRP
  • Understanding of F5 Load balancer techniques
  • Understanding of VPN techniques such as GRE, IPSec and SSL
  • Understanding of scripting language/tools such as Python / Ansible / Terraform
